Aluminum 6061 is a precipitation-hardened alloy renowned for its excellent strength-to-weight ratio, good corrosion resistance, and ease of fabrication. Its inherent properties make it ideal for fabricating robust enclosures, manifolds, mounting brackets, and structural elements within complex pneumatic systems where reliability and longevity are paramount.
